Dr. John D. Harris, 86, of Palmer, MA, passed away and went to be with the Lord on Friday, July 31 2026. Son of the late H. Lee and Ella (Ogle) Harris, he was born in Richlands, VA on April 2, 1946. A graduate of Bristol, TN High School, he earned B.S. from the University of Tennessee and his doctorate from Southern College of Optometry. A respected Optometrist, he practiced for over 60 years in the greater Springfield area. He was a devout Christian and a founding member of Pilgrim Baptist Church in North Brookfield.
